二、导出全库表结构
– 使用命令行导出ch导出
三、注意事项
– 导出格式选择
– 导出文件存放位置
– 导出文件编码格式
四、相关问题解决
– 导出文件乱码问题
– 导出速度慢的问题
ysql导出全库表结构,以及注意事项和相关问题的解决方案。
一、准备工作
在开始导出之前,需要确认以下几点:ysqlysqlysql版本。ysql用户权限:需要使用具备导出权限的用户进行导出操作。
二、导出全库表结构
使用命令行导出
1. 打开命令行工具,输入以下命令:
“`ysqldumpameoameame.sql
“`ameysqlame为需要导出的数据库名称。ysql用户密码,回车确认。
3. 导出完成后,将在当前目录下生成一个以数据库名称命名的.sql文件。
ch导出ch,连接到需要导出的数据库。
2. 在导航栏中选择Server ->Data Export。s。。
5. 勾选需要导出的数据库和表。
6. 点击Start Export按钮,导出完成后将在指定位置生成一个.sql文件。
三、注意事项
导出格式选择
– .sql格式:可直接在MySQL中执行,适用于备份和迁移。
– .csv格式:适用于数据分析和处理。
导出文件存放位置
– 可以将导出文件存放在本地,也可以存放在远程服务器上。
导出文件编码格式
– 推荐使用UTF-8编码格式,以避免导出文件乱码问题。
四、相关问题解决
导出文件乱码问题
– 在导出命令中添加–default-character-set=utf8选项。chsced ->Character Set中选择UTF-8。
导出速度慢的问题
– 在导出命令中添加–skip-lock-tables选项,以避免锁表导致的速度慢问题。
ysql导出全库表结构,以及注意事项和相关问题的解决方案。在进行数据库备份和迁移时,务必要注意数据安全和导出格式选择。